Women in Steel by Jenny Elizabeth Johnstone. Workers Library Publishers, New York. April, 1937.

Contents: Foreword, The Tribute, Wage Scale, Where Is Our Home?, Labor’s Fortresses, The Steel Workers Organizing Committee, In Organization There Is Strength, Big Responsibilities, Declaration of Independence, Resolution, How to Organize an Auxiliary, Organization Puts Plans Into Action, Divide and Rule, The Strength of Our Negro Sisters, Branching Out, New Friends, We Grab Our Sisters From the Economic Royalists. 30 pages.

Workers Library Publishers replaced Daily Workers Publishers as the main pamphlet printing house of the Communist Party in 1927. International Publishers was originally meant to translate works into English, but became the CP’s main book publisher.
